Abstract
Since the first witness of a cluster of Asian giant hornet in Canada, the Asian giant hornet, which is also called Vespa mandarinia, has caused serious ecological problems. Therefore, in order to detect Asian giant hornet and collect sighting reports from witnesses, the state of Washington has created a website for people to submit their reports. However, most reported sightings mistake other hornets for the Vespa mandarinia. In order to Identify the image of Vespa mandarinia efficiently, based on convolution neural network, we introduced an improved VGG-16 algorithm to solve the problem. By comparing the results of two experiments, the accuracy of treatment group is better than control group.
